El problema puede estar en los enlaces permanentes o el archivo .htaccess. Por favor, dime:
1. ¿Has cambiado los enlaces permanentes en WordPress?
2. ¿Tienes un archivo .htaccess en /var/www/html/wp_nitida/?
3. ¿Usas Apache o Nginx?
User
06/08/2025 04:36
Apache, contenido .htaccess:
# BEGIN WordPress
# Les directives (línies) entre "BEGIN WordPress" i "END WordPress" es generen dinàmicament i haurien de ser solament modificades mitjançant els filtres del WordPress.
# Qualsevol canvi entre aquestes marques se sobreescriuran.
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teRule .* - [E=HTTP_AUTHORIZATION:%{HTTP:Authorization}]
RewriteBase /wp_nitida/
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/wp_nitida/index.php [L]
</IfModule>
# END WordPress
Kodee
06/08/2025 04:36
La configuración de .htaccess parece correcta. Es probable que mod_rewrite no esté habilitado o que AllowOverride no esté en All. Pasos:
1. Habilita mod_rewrite: sudo a2enmod rewrite && sudo systemctl reload apache2
2. Verifica AllowOverride en /etc/apache2/sites-available/000-default.conf: <Directory /var/www/html/wp_nitida>
AllowOverride All
</Directory>
3. Reinicia Apache: sudo systemctl restart apache2
¿Quieres que revise si mod_rewrite y AllowOverride están configurados?
Kodee
06/08/2025 04:35
El problema puede estar en los enlaces permanentes o el archivo .htaccess. Por favor, dime:
1. ¿Has cambiado los enlaces permanentes en WordPress?
2. ¿Tienes un archivo .htaccess en /var/www/html/wp_nitida/?
3. ¿Usas Apache o Nginx?
User
06/08/2025 04:36
Apache, contenido .htaccess:
# BEGIN WordPress
# Les directives (línies) entre "BEGIN WordPress" i "END WordPress" es generen dinàmicament i haurien de ser solament modificades mitjançant els filtres del WordPress.
# Qualsevol canvi entre aquestes marques se sobreescriuran.
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teRule .* - [E=HTTP_AUTHORIZATION:%{HTTP:Authorization}]
RewriteBase /wp_nitida/
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/wp_nitida/index.php [L]
</IfModule>
# END WordPress
Kodee
06/08/2025 04:36
La configuración de .htaccess parece correcta. Es probable que mod_rewrite no esté habilitado o que AllowOverride no esté en All. Pasos:
1. Habilita mod_rewrite:
sudo a2enmod rewrite && sudo systemctl reload apache2
2. Verifica AllowOverride en /etc/apache2/sites-available/000-default.conf:
<Directory /var/www/html/wp_nitida>
AllowOverride All
</Directory>
3. Reinicia Apache:
sudo systemctl restart apache2
¿Quieres que revise si mod_rewrite y AllowOverride están configurados?